    Hello,

    I have 4 calendars configured, under the default MM2 calendar module

    		{
    			module: 'calendar',
    			header: 'Calendar',
    			position: 'top_left',
    			config: {
    				maxTitleLength: 50,
    				maximumEntries: 20,
    				wrapEvents: true,
    				fadePoint: 0.8,
    				colored: true,
    				dateFormat: 'ddd MMM Do hh:mma',
    				dateEndFormat: 'ddd MMM Do hh:mma',
    				timeFormat: 'absolute',
    				useRelativeDates: true,
    				columns: false,
    				urgency: 0,
    				titleReplace: {
    					'USA: ': ''
    					},
    				calendars: [
    						{
    							symbol: 'trash-o',
    							color: '#CCCC00',
    							showLocation: false,
    							url: 'webcal://recollect.a.ssl.fastly.net/api/places/**masked**/events.en-US.ics'
    						},
    						{
    							symbol: 'calendar',
    							color: '#9CECC4',
    							showLocation: true,
    							url: 'webcal://p64-calendars.icloud.com/published/2/**masked**'
    						},
    						{
    							symbol: 'calendar-o',
    							color: '#A2D7FF',
    							showLocation: false,
    							url: 'webcal://ical.mac.com/ical/US32Holidays.ics'
    						},
    						{
    							symbol: '',
    							color: '#FF6600',
    							showLocation: false,
    							url: 'webcal://p42-calendars.icloud.com/published/2/**masked**--sxGM'
    						},
    					],
    				excludedEvents: []
    			}
    		},
    

    And when the calendars are refreshed it appears that whatever the last one in the config list is gets loaded an extra time for each one of the other calendars configured is this normal/expected behavior?

          @vvrangler the fix i proposed has been accepted and is part of the develop branch, if you would like to use it

          to get there

          if you did manual install

          cd ~/MagicMirror
          git checkout develop
          git pull
          

          restart MagicMirror as normal

          if you used my install script

          cd ~/MagicMirror
          git fetch origin develop:develop
          git checkout develop
          

          restart MagicMirror as normal

              @vvrangler yeh, it seems to luck out currently

              the top code starts the fetcher and a starts a timer for each calendar entry
              the fetcher ALSO starts a timer, so if its never called again, it still returns a refreshed list

              I changed it so the top code starts the fetcher for each calendar entry
              and let the fetcher handle its configured timer cycle
